UNIMAID Signs MoU With Opay For ₦1.2bn Scholarship Scheme.

The University has officially entered into a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with OPay Digital Services, joining a select group of North-East universities set to benefit from a ₦1.2 billion, ten-year scholarship initiative. The signing ceremony took place on Wednesday, 20th August, 2025, at the university’s Annex building.

Mr. Itoro Udo, Head of Corporate Social Responsibility at OPay, stated that the programme aims to alleviate the financial challenges faced by students and empower their academic pursuits. Under the scheme, twenty students of the University will receive annual scholarships of ₦300,000 each, totaling ₦60 million allocated to the university over the ten-year period.

“This scholarship reflects our commitment to investing in young people and making education more accessible, particularly in regions where opportunities are limited,” Mr. Udo emphasized.

Representing the Vice Chancellor, Professor Yakubu Muktar, Dean of the College of Postgraduate Studies, expressed heartfelt appreciation to OPay for the initiative. He noted that the scholarship would not only ease financial pressure on students but also motivate them to strive for academic excellence.

The University is proud to be one of the 16 institutions selected for this impactful programme. It stands as a significant investment in the university’s student and the future of the nation at large.
